Abstract:
Objective To compare the baroreflex sensitivity (BRS) when controlled hypotension was performed with sevoflurane versus isoflurane in the pediatric patients.Methods Sixty male American Society of Anesthesiologists physical status Ⅰ or Ⅱ patients,aged 3-16 yr,with body mass index of 20-28 kg/m2,scheduled for elective scoliosis surgery under general anesthesia,were randomly divided into 2 groups (n=30 each) using a random number table:sevoflurane-induced hypotension group (group Sev) and isoflurane-induced hypotension group (group Iso).Anesthesia was induced with midazolam,sufentanil and propofol.Endotracheal intubation was facilitated with rocuronium.Anesthesia was maintained with closed-circuit low flow anesthesia with either sevoflurane or isoflurane,maintaining mean arterial pressure at 55-65 mmHg and bispectral index values at 40-60 during surgery.Cardiovascular BRS was measured before induction of anesthesia (T0),immediately after intubation (T1),immediately after the end-tidal inhalational anesthetic concentration reached 1 minimal alveolar concentration (T2),and at 10,20 and 30 min after target hypotension (mean arterial pressure 55-65 mmHg) was achieved (T3-5).Results There was no significant difference in BRS at T0-2 between the two groups (P>0.05).Compared with the value at To,the BRS was significantly decreased at the other time points in the two groups (P<0.05).Compared with the value at T1,the BRS was significantly increased at T2,and decreased at T3-5 in the two groups (P<0.05).The BRS was significantly lower at T3-5 than at T2 in the two groups (P<0.05).The BRS was significantly lower at T3-5 in group Sev than in group Iso in the two groups (P<0.05).Conclusion Sevoflurane produces better efficacy than isoflurane when used for controlled hypotension in the pediatric patients.
